In a Nutshell:
Bill and June are in a tailspin. Bill lost his business and June had to give up being a stay at home mom. There is a killer on the loose.
Looking for a better life, the family moves from the big city suburbs to rural South Dakota. The story is a light-hearted tale of culture shock and humor.
The book is broken down into easy to read chapters. You can read most chapters as a short story. However, the whole thing strings together into a novel about a family in transition from city to country.
